ARLINGTON, Va., May 14, 2011 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- RPJ Housing, a leading non-profit provider of affordable housing in Northern Virginia, has announced an initiative to enhance its regulatory compliance.
"Just like any other business, non-profit affordable housing providers have numerous reports, forms, and certifications that must be completed, said RPJ Housing executive director Eric Bonetti. "These forms are important and require a high degree of accuracy and precision. We therefore have launched an initiative to improve our recordkeeping and reporting, and to ensure that we provide our funding sources with the best possible information."
The effort is being led by an outside property management firm and is expected to last for several months.
About RPJ Housing
RPJ Housing was founded in 1978 by the Rev. Robert Pierre Johnson, a minister in the National Capital Presbytery who was committed to serving the community.
A 501 (c)(3) non-profit organization, RPJ Housing today continues its original mission of developing and preserving affordable housing for limited income individuals and families in the Northern Virginia area. RPJ Housing offers a continuum of affordable housing opportunities, with an emphasis on providing group homes and permanent supportive housing, and on preserving smaller properties in older, established neighborhoods.
